From 29 September to 3 October, architect and skater Tun Kintzele will host a hands-on workshop at the old slaughterhouse in Hollerich. Together, you’ll pour, shape and finish DIY concrete skate modules, following every step from the first pour to the final touch. By the end of the week, a skatespot will have taken shape, built in the raw spirit of underground skate culture.🛹

On 4 October, the spot opens with a full day of action. Expect a skate jam, skate-for-tricks sessions and DJ sets, with drinks on site. Besides the skateboarding, you can join creative workshops in the form of art, upcycling concepts and photography. Take part in a round-table talk with key figures of the local scene to close the day.
Programme:
🛠 Walk-in Workshop: Skateboarding DIY Basics
⏰ 14:00 – 16:00
Learn how to ride a DIY skatepark: check the spot, feel the surfaces, start small, and adapt to the flow. Ride safe, respect the space, and enjoy unique handmade features.
🎨 Walk-in Workshop: Art on Boards
⏰ 14:00 – 17:00
Customize your own skate deck with artist Sacha di Giambattista. Finished boards will be shown at the Schluechthaus in a temporary exhibition.
♻️ Walk-in Workshop: Upcycling Skateboards
⏰ 14:00 – 17:00
Give old boards a second life! With Atelier 3, explore creative and sustainable ways of repurposing skateboards.
📸 Workshop: Photography
⏰ 15:00 – 17:00
Discover how to capture skateboarding’s energy and urban aesthetics with photographer Tom Jungbluth. Limited spots!
👉 Registration: [email protected]
🛹 Skatejam
⏰ 16:00 – 18:00
Skate demos & community vibes with Skateboard Club Hollerech + live DJ set!
💸 Cash for Tricks Competition
⏰ 18:15 – 19:00
A friendly contest rewarding creativity and style. Show your best tricks!
💬 Roundtable Discussion
⏰ 19:00 – 20:00
With Dan Gantrel & Nicolas Calmes: an open talk on urban practices, public spaces & community life.
